Which major work by Shelley is a four-act lyrical drama that reinterprets a Greek myth to symbolize the victory of the human spirit over tyranny?

  1. The Cenci, a verse tragedy
  2. Prometheus Unbound
  3. Alastor, a narrative poem
  4. Queen Mab, a political fantasy
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: Prometheus Unbound

Prometheus Unbound is Shelley's response to Aeschylus. In Shelley's version, Prometheus is liberated not through a compromise with Jupiter, but through the power of love and the inevitable downfall of the tyrant.
